JDK 1.8 이상을 설치 : www.oracle.com 다운로드
android studio 를 설치 : developer.android.com
안드로이드 스튜디오 설치 후
1. 에뮬레이터 추가
2. SDK 추가 (최신 버전 이외의 API를 사용하고자 하는 경우와 Google Play 사용 하는 경우)
안드로이드 작업 단위
1. Project : 1 개 이상의 앱을 관리하기 위한 단위
=> Project 를 생성하면 1개의 모듈이 자동으로 추가
2. Module : 1 개의 앱
=> 생성하면 1 개의 Activity를 자동으로 추가
3. Activity : 1 개의 화면
6.0 Marshmallow : 카메라 버전
8.0 Oreo : pip 동영상 올리고 내리고
9.0 Q : AI
10.0 R : 텐서플로 데이터 분석
AVD : 안드로이드 에뮬레이터
=> 안드로이드 앱을 실행시켜보기 위한 툴
=> 맨 처음에는 제공 되지 않기 때문에 생성
[Tools] - [AVD Manager] 를 실행
컴포넌트 기반 개발
클래스는 개발자가 만들지만 인스턴스는 개발자가 만드는 게 아니다.
실제 클래스의 인스턴스는 안드로이드가 만든다.
4 개의 컴포넌트
'안드로이드' 카테고리의 다른 글
안드로이드 : GUI 시스템에서 UI 갱신과 Logcat (0) | 2020.10.27 |
---|---|
안드로이드 : 레이아웃과 이벤트 처리 (0) | 2020.10.27 |
안드로이드 : 화면 출력 (0) | 2020.10.26 |
안드로이드 프로젝트 구성 (0) | 2020.10.22 |
안드로이드 초기 진입 코드와 상속 (0) | 2020.10.15 |